1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is commensalism?

Back

A type of ecological relationship where one organism benefits while the other is neither helped nor harmed.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Give an example of commensalism.

Back

Vines growing on a tree, where the vines benefit from light but the tree is unaffected.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is parasitism?

Back

A relationship between two organisms where one benefits at the expense of the other, causing harm.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Give an example of parasitism.

Back

A tick feeding on a dog's blood.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is mutualism?

Back

A type of ecological relationship where both organisms benefit from the interaction.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Give an example of mutualism.

Back

A bird eating insects off a horse's back, benefiting both the bird and the horse.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is predation?

Back

An ecological relationship where one organism (the predator) hunts and eats another organism (the prey).
